Overview:

  • The Republic of Peru has issued €1.1 billion in bonds which reach maturity in 2026.
  • This was said to be the country's first euro-denominated bond issuance in 10 years.
  • BBVA, JPMorgan and BNP Paribas acted as underwriters.
  • Hernández & Cía Abogados (José Manuel Abastos) and Simpson Thacher & Bartlett advised the issuer.
  • Miranda & Amado (Juan Luis Avendaño) and Shearman & Sterling (Antonia Stolper) advised the underwriters.
